** The Acura repair market in Dubuque is moderately competitive but lacks a dedicated, independent Acura-only specialist. The market is effectively segmented: * **The Dealership (McGrath Acura):** Occupies the top tier for warranty work, complex electronic/software issues, and guaranteed OEM part compatibility. Their pricing is at a premium, but they offer unparalleled access to brand-specific tools and technical service bulletins. * **High-End Independents (e.g., Dubuque Auto Service):** These shops represent the best value for owners of out-of-warranty Acuras. They provide near-dealer level expertise on mechanical systems (SH-AWD, VTEC, transmissions) at a more competitive labor rate, driven by strong reputations and long-term community presence. * **National Chains (e.g., Car-X):** Provide a solid, warranty-backed option for more common repairs and maintenance. Their ability to handle highly specialized Acura issues may vary based on the specific technicians on staff.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are tiered. Dealerships are typically **$145 - $165/hour**, high-end independents range from **$115 - $135/hour**, and national chains are often **$100 - $120/hour**. Parts markups follow a similar structure. For Acura owners, the choice often comes down to the specific repair needed—complex electronic issues lean toward the dealer, while mechanical and diagnostic work is often expertly handled by the top independents at a significant cost savings.
